NE_HAS_SUPPORT(3)	      neon API reference	     NE_HAS_SUPPORT(3)

NAME
       ne_has_support -	determine feature support status

SYNOPSIS
       #include	<ne_utils.h>

       int ne_has_support(int feature);

DESCRIPTION
       The ne_has_support function can be used to determine whether a
       particular optional feature, given by the feature code feature, is
       supported. The following	feature	codes are available:

       NE_FEATURE_SSL
	   Indicates support for SSL/TLS

       NE_FEATURE_ZLIB
	   Indicates support for compressed responses

       NE_FEATURE_IPV6
	   Indicates support for IPv6

       NE_FEATURE_LFS
	   Indicates support for large files

       NE_FEATURE_SOCKS
	   Indicates support for SOCKSv5

       NE_FEATURE_TS_SSL
	   Indicates support for thread-safe SSL initialization	-- see
	   ne_sock_init

RETURN VALUE
       ne_has_support returns non-zero if the given feature is supported, or
       zero otherwise.
